Protesters to host rally at Michigan Rep. Barrett’s office against ‘big ugly bill’

LANSING, Mich. (WLNS) — The Michigan Families for Fair Care, Sierra Club Michigan, and the Climate Action Campaign will host a protest outside U.S. Rep. Tom Barrett’s (MI-07) office on Thursday afternoon to express their concerns about the bill’s impact on climate and clean energy funding.

The protest will take place from 4:00 p.m. to 6:00 p.m. Participants say they will wear Halloween costumes to highlight their disappointment with Barrett’s support for the bill, which they refer to as the “Big Ugly Bill.”

“As the Trump administration has begun implementing aspects of the bill, Lansing locals are bracing for the impact of funding cuts that were tackling the climate crisis while also creating jobs and growing the state economy. Now Trump and Congressional Republicans are rewarding big oil companies and rich contributors while middle and lower income citizens suffer the consequences with dirtier air, higher utility bills and fewer new manufacturing jobs,” the Climate Action Campaign said in a news release sent to 6 News.
